Description

The Museum Educator's Manual addresses the role museum educators play in today's museums from an experience-based perspective.

Seasoned museum educators author each chapter, emphasizing key programs along with case studies that provide successful examples, and demonstrate a practical foundation for the daily operations of a museum education department, no matter how small.

The book covers:*volunteer and docent management and training; *exhibit development; *program and event design and implementation; *working with families, seniors, and teens; *collaborating with schools and other institutions; and *funding.

This second edition interweaves technology into every aspect of the manual and includes two entirely new chapters, one on Museums - An Educational Resource for Schools and another on Active Learning in Museums.
